Table Of Contents
Silicon dreams : states, markets, and the transnational high-tech suburb / Margaret O'Mara -- Homeownership and social welfare in the Americas : Ciudad Kennedy as a midcentury crossroads / Amy C. Offner -- Building the alliance for progress : local and transnational encounters in a low-income housing program in Rio de Janeiro, 1962-67 / Leandro Benmergui -- Slum clearance as a transnational process in globalizing Manila / Nancy H. Kwak -- Crossing boundaries : the global exchange of planning ideas / Carola Hein -- Condos in the mall : suburban transnational typological transformations in Markham, Ontario / Erica Allen-Kim -- Requiem for a barrio : race, space, and gentrification in southern California / Matthew J. García -- Transnational performances in Chicago's Independence Day parade / Arijit Sen -- Transnational urban meanings : the passage of "suburb" to India and its rough reception / Richard Harris -- Suburbanization and urban practice in India / Nikhil Rao -- Will the transnational city be digitized? The dialectics of diversified spatial media and expanded spatial scopes / Carl H. Nightingale
